Ready to race? It's nearly go time for King of the Mountain, presented by Lincoln Powersports, and we're looking forward to seeing you all here this weekend. A few nuggets to take note of:

• Tech Check and Bib Pick Up will take place tomorrow from 1-6pm. As always, you'll need to go through tech check in the parking lot and receive a stamp from race staff before you can pick up your race bib in the Base Lodge.
• It's extremely important to get checked and pick up your bib tomorrow, if at all possible. There will be a late check-in period on Saturday morning from 6-8am, but at 8am we shut off all check-ins. If you miss it, you're out of luck.
• Online registration for the Kids Race will close tomorrow at 12pm. In person registration for the Kids Race will continue through Saturday morning. Pre-registered kids can pick up their bibs tomorrow from 1-6pm, or from 9-11am on Saturday at the Rangeley Chair.
• Spectator Tickets are still available and are $25 when purchased online in advance, or $35 at the gate.

Weather is looking great for Saturday, and we're ready for a fun day of racing. See you here!
